Bandar Seri Begawan – Forty-seven per cent of poll respondents in the second BSB Development Masterplan survey said they would support a reduction of Brunei’s petrol subsidy so that the funds could be redistributed to increase subsidies for public transport, such as the Light Rail Transport (LRT) system proposed under the Masterplan.
However, a significant portion were still hesitant about removing the subsidy, with 34 per cent stating they might support the initiative, and three per cent stating they would not.
The Municipal Department polled a total of 647 individuals by handing out questionnaires and placing the survey on the BSB Masterplan and The Brunei Times websites.
When asked that disincentive was needed for car us to shift to public transport, the majority of respondents commented that raising the price petrol was the biggest deterrent, with a significant number saying increasing the price of cars by way of tax could be another way to encourage public to use mass transit.
Others replied that the LRT would have to provide convenience and comfort to passengers and be cheaper than car use to be considered a viable alternative. Several added that the traffic congestion and lack of available parking were other disincentives.
A vast number stated that any public transport system must be convenient and reliable with punctual timetabling.
Nonetheless, 48 per cent of the poll-takers think car users would switch to LRT if making a journey within the LRT corridor, which would service 24 stops between Yayasan Sultan Haji Hassanal Bolkiah Shopping Complex and Brunei International Airport.
A ride from start to finish would take less than 25 minutes, and the frequency of the trams would be every three minutes.
Furthermore, 72 per cent said they would use the LRT service if the fare structure was similar to the ‘purple buses’, which charge $1 for a one-way journey anywhere within its network.
The rail line would link key commercial and administrative areas, including Gadong, Kiulap, Serusop, government offices in Berakas and Raja Isteri Pengiran Anak Saleha (Ripas) Hospital.
The consultants also plan to have "Park and Ride" facilities at five LRT stations where people can leave their vehicles at multi-level car parks and board the tram to their destination.
Several stops will also have bus and water taxi connections, which can cover routes outside the BSB municipal boundaries.
Mizan Hj Jalil from the Municipal Department told The Brunei Times that the public response to the second survey, particularly from students, was overwhelming. Forty-four per cent of poll respondents were aged 17 years or younger.
While The Brunei Times collected 139 responses on our website, Mizan said the Municipal Department had actually collected over 700 responses from www.bsbmasterplan.com.bn and in hard copy format but were unable to include over 200 of them in their data analysis because they were submitted after the cut-off date.
"Our website contained 500 plus responses but actually we have more than 700 plus responses but we need a cut off date due to insufficient time for our consultants to analyse the data before their next workshop," he said. "It is very unfortunate for us to omit the remaining 200 plus responses due to this unavoidable problem."
The data collected from the 55-question survey will be used by the consultants of the BSB Masterplan to formulate the final version of the plan which is slated for release in September.

Nissan’s 370Z Roadster possesses a stunning, sleek and taut design. Nissan took great pains to ensure that the car retained its sleek look regardless of whether the roof was up or down.
Made from cloth for its weight-saving benefits, the 370Z Roadster’s power roof is now a fully automated unit.
The Roadster’s feature list is the folding softtop, which raises or lowers in 20 sec and features an automatic-locking mechanism at the windshield.
This means no more fighting with latches and such; just push the button and watch it work.
From the get-go, the new 370Z was designed to be stiffer, lighter and more powerful than the old 350Z, and these positive traits extend to the convertible. The 370Z Roadster is a full 150 pounds lighter than the old 350Z convertible, and just 200 pounds heavier than the new 370Z coupe. With the new roadster boasting a larger and more powerful 3.7-liter, 332-horsepower V6, the convertible’s extra poundage is barely noticeable.

Ingolstadt , August 4 , 2010 – Thanks to the “AudiMedia” App , journalists and media representatives can now quickly and easily access information from AUDI AG. No matter where , no matter when: the Audi app offers the latest press texts , photographic materials and videos regarding the Four Rings.
“The AudiMedia App for on the go is especially suitable for journalists who travel a lot , ” says
Toni Melfi , Head of Audi Communications. “Suppose an editor writing on a train or at the airport requires an appropriate photo for their piece or needs to look up something. Well , they no longer need a computer connected to the Internet. Instead , with the iPhone , iPad and iPod touch , they’re just one click away from the AudiMedia App.” The app can be called up in German or English.
This app allows Audi to transmit news and images in an especially user-friendly manner. The home page is continuously updated and provides media representatives with as many as 20 key news items regarding Audi. Users then view content by means of a media-rich ticker. Here journalists can find photos , videos , and complete press releases – configured specifically for the iPhone.
Using a scroll menu at the top of the app , it is possible to activate a filter so that topic-specific articles will be displayed. Whether company news , product information , motorsport results or lifestyle topics: categories mirror those of Audi MediaServices and provide in-depth information.
People who use their iPhone , iPad or iPod touch as a mobile office will enjoy two features in particular. First , Audi provides a calendar which highlights not only Audi events in the near future but also upcoming press events. In the Contacts category , press representatives will find the relevant contact person from Audi Communications who they can call directly or send an e-mail.
The contact information of the press spokespeople can also be saved directly in the journalists’ own directory.
“Naturally , this app also features an overview of Audi’s current portfolio of products , ” says Stephan Öri , Head of Product and Technology Communications. Users choose a model line by means of an animated selector wheel. From A (as in A1) to T (as in TT): the MediaApp has every model. Similar to a combination lock , there are two further selector wheels which enable the user to find the model version he is looking for: one for S and RS models , and one for Cabriolet , Sportback and Avant versions. A final wheel then shows the media formats which are available for the topic in question.
Audi has made this new research tool available for download free of charge at the Apple App Store. Once journalists have installed the program , they can use all of the app’s content without even being online. Audi’s on-the-go press database will be immediately updated every time a user’s iPhone , iPad or iPod touch connects to the Internet.
Journalists are not the only ones who can download this free tool. End users , bloggers and Apple fans may also install this program on their iPhone , iPad or iPod touch to access a public area of the AudiMedia App. In the password-protected version , registered journalists will find exclusive press materials and the Audi contact persons.

Boustead Sdn Bhd has launched the 7th Generation Suzuki Alto on saturday night. The Suzuki Alto is a very small car (kei car) designed by Suzuki, Its selling points include low price and good fuel economy. Now the new generation Suzuki Alto is more cute and eye cathching design. The Alto is powered by a 1.0 liter petrol engine developing 68 hp at 6,000 rpm and 90 Nm of torque at 4,800 rpm mated to a choice between a 5-speed manual or a 4-speed automatic gearbox. Fuel consumption is low at 62.7 mpg on the combined cycle and CO2 emissions are just 103g/km.
The new Alto is aimed mainly at urban people who want a small car that offers style and enjoyment together with great environmental credentials, and it reflects the ideals of the second phase of Suzuki’s world strategy.

With less then 3 weeks until the inaugural Audi quattro Cup Brunei 2010 Charity Golf Tournament, entries are slowly but steadily coming in from excited golfers in the sultanate.
The team at the end of the 3-day tournament with the top scores will win an unforgettable 5-day golfing experience at the exclusive Pervero Club in Sardinia, Italy. Pevero was officially recognized as one of the best courses in the world (Ranked by Golf Magazine in the top fifty in the world).
And one lucky golfer via a lucky draw will drive away a brand new Audi A3 Sportback 2.0 TFSI worth over $53,000 in what is probably the biggest golf prize in the region.
The prize presentation and lucky draw will be held after the final morning session on Sunday 8th August at the Empire Golf & Country Club in Jerudong.
The organiser T.C.Y. Motors Sdn Bhd will also make a donation from the entry fees to the Dana Pg Muda Mahkota Al-Muhtadee Billah for orphans and the Learning Ladders Society Brunei which is timely with the holy month of Ramadan starting on the following week.
The Audi quattro Cup amateur golf tournament marks its 20th anniversary this year -with over a million golfers worldwide participating since 1991 it is truly the World’s largest amateur golf tournament; and Audi quattro®, the very technology that the Audi quattro Cup is named after is also celebrating its 30th birthday.
